What to know about Data Analytics
Data Analytics is a rapidly evolving field that empowers organizations to extract meaningful insights from vast volumes of data. It encompasses a broad range of techniques, including natural language processing, predictive analytics, AI integration, and real-time data processing, all aimed at driving better decision-making across industries.
Recent advancements highlight its applications in numerous sectors, such as healthcare, logistics, finance, retail, and education. From enhancing customer experience and operational efficiency to supporting sustainability initiatives and mitigating risks, data analytics is becoming an indispensable tool in today’s digital landscape.
